Output 3ca3c01cf414c7a94f02475011107215c5e4bfa4ed3855d03ec407e6650c5130:3

value
104489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72eb43c9113684215b7c2d4b9e61cb5dc6f8eb9c OP_EQUAL
address
3CAentwgNLb7Uf8q2ZD9kS5jUT99KjcfRq
transaction
3ca3c01cf414c7a94f02475011107215c5e4bfa4ed3855d03ec407e6650c5130
spent
true